Generally the build can look like

Source selector (Controller Bundle up 4-6 sources) -> R2R Volume Control -> Output Buffer (any buffer that you would like to use)

And you can get a simple and good controlled pre-amplifier unit.

Hi and thank´s!

Currently i use my new built PA03 Gainclone, my Firstwatt Aleph J have to step aside for awile.

About on/off, i wanted a green led for the standby function. Tibi told that i could use J7. So J7 and Vcc+ from the update firmware pin with a resistor works perfect with the standby called on/off on my VC front.
